Spiders Win Third Straight, 3-1, Over Longwood
08/31/2008 | Women's Soccer
Aug. 31, 2008
Farmville, Va. -
The Spiders equaled their best start in school history with a 3-1 victory over host team, Longwood University. Junior midfielder Kelsey Rdzanek scored her second goal of the season on a ball assisted by both freshman Kat Russell and senior Jessie Wolfe.
Richmond struck again at the 64:48 mark when freshman forward Emily Dale scored on an assist by senior Sarah Hilt. The Spiders then sealed the win with the last goal coming from junior forward . Mann scored on a header from a cross pass by freshman Bridget Kinaely and Hilt at the 81:08 mark.
The Lancers scored their lone goal at the 73:24 mark in the second half when junior Michelle DeSieno served the ball from the right side of the box, and a defender deflected the ball in the net.
Richmond dominated shots on goal, with an 11-2 advantage. The Spiders return to action next Friday night against the College of Charleston in the Davidson College Tournament. Kick-off is slated for 4:30 p.m. at Davidson College.
